Person    | Male  Born 25/8/1857  Died 12/7/1937

Lord Elcho

Categories: Politics & Administration

Countries: Scotland

Politician. Born Hugo Richard Charteris in Scotland. Entered parliament first in 1883 and again in 1886. He gained the titles 11th Earl of Wemyss and 7th Earl of March.
